Screaming like a girl

Last night I went and saw The Descent, and have come to terms with the fact that I suck at watching scary movies.Official movie poster Despite the movie following the S.O.P of any horror/thriller movie, I still found myself with my face buried in my hands at certain times. i still jumped despite music cues and other obvious signs of death and gore lurking around the corner. The movie follows a group of six adventure seeking girlfriends who go on a spelunking trip to help one of the girls regain her confidence a year after her husband and daughter were killed in a car accident. The cave they explore is uncharted and one of the girl’s (named Juno) ego complicates their exit from the subterranean maze where they encounter a band of Gollum-look-alike creatures which proceed to devour the majority of the girls. The film is filled with estrogen charged girly arguments and the weak script made it difficult to watch at times (although the film got good reviews). It was funny to watch the girls get pissed off and fight the creatures off. In the end, I’ve decided that European movies do not compare with the ridiculousness of American films, and that although I am quite ashamed of admitting it, I was screaming like a little girl (on the inside)during this movie…but we’ll keep that between you and me.

In the mean time, I’ll stick to movies I can handle like Talladega Nights and The Lion King. And despite the fact that I am the candy-less kid relative to the movie theatre, I still have a few movies to see.
